How to Get to Chengdu
Chengdu is one of China's major transportation hubs in Southwest China, with convenient connections by air and high-speed rail.
By Air
Chengdu is served by two airports:
Chengdu Tianfu International Airport:The main international airport with many domestic and international connections.
Chengdu Shuangliu International Airport:A convenient airport closer to the city center.
Both airports provide metro, taxi, and private transfer options for travelers.
Airport to Chengdu City Center
Metro:Affordable and convenient for travelers with light luggage.
Taxi:Suitable for families, groups, or travelers with luggage.
Didi:A convenient option for direct transportation.
Private Transfer:Recommended for families, first-time visitors, and travelers arriving late.

Getting Around Chengdu City
Metro
Best for independent travelers visiting major attractions and central districts.
Didi Ride-Hailing
Didi is one of the most convenient ways to travel in Chengdu, especially when traveling with luggage, children, or visiting locations away from metro stations.
Taxi
Taxis are widely available and suitable for short-distance travel or situations where metro access is inconvenient.
Public Bus
Buses cover extensive areas of Chengdu and can be useful for local travelers, although most international visitors prefer metro and ride-hailing services.
Walking
Some Chengdu areas are best explored on foot, especially Kuanzhai Alley, Jinli Ancient Street, Chunxi Road, and People's Park.

Chengdu High-Speed Rail Guide
Chengdu's high-speed railway network makes it convenient to explore destinations throughout Sichuan Province and beyond.
Chengdu Railway Stations
Chengdu East Railway Station:The main high-speed rail station for many long-distance routes.
Chengdu South Railway Station:Serves some regional routes.
